You will need baking soda, a soft sponge or cloth, vinegar, and warm water. Coat your sink lightly with baking soda. Sanitize with vinegar (including faucets and sink handles) rinse thoroughly. How to clean a sink drain with baking soda & vinegar. You can clean sink drains and remove minor sink clogs using a mixture of baking soda and vinegar. The fizzy chemical reaction is ideal for dissolving sink clogs caused by grease, toothpaste or soap buildup. Whether you've got a clogged sink, garbage disposal,.
